SofiBuddy: A Soft Mobile Interface for On-Body Interaction
Soft Robotics | HRI | PCB | CAD | Wearables | Haptic | Ecoflex | Pneumatic Actuation
overview.
Designed and developed SofiBuddy, a biomimetic soft robotic interface for intimate on-body interaction. We engineered a 10.2g lightweight transition module using a rack-and-pinion system to convert high-torque motor rotation into linear displacement for wearable applications. By implementing a curvature-based pneumatic control system with ESP32 and miniature diaphragm pumps, the project explores the integration of silicone-based compliant mechanisms with real-time haptic feedback in VR environments.
